Here is the text from draft-thomson-geopriv-3825bis-03:

2.4.1. No Known Altitude (AT = 0)

In some cases, the altitude of the location might not be known. An
altitude type of 0 indicates that the altitude is not known. In this
case, the altitude and altitude uncertainty fields can contain any
value and are ignored.
